What's The Definition Of MMR?
MMR
MMR is a vaccine that is given to young children to protect them against certain diseases. MMR is an abbreviation for measles, mumps, and rubella. MMR in American English measles, mumps, and rubella (vaccine or vaccination) MMR in British English abbreviation for: measles, mumps, and rubella: a combined vaccine given to young children |
